Advertisement

Qt语言包批量翻译脚本及详解(详尽版)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文提供了一个用于批量翻译Qt语言文件的脚本,并详细解释了其工作原理和使用方法。适合需要高效管理多国语言资源的开发者阅读。 Qt语言家批量翻译脚本附详细说明:指定需要更新的.ts文件,以空格分隔,可以批量更新。将该脚本放置在正确目录下,并将.txt文件改名为.bat后可以直接双击运行。此方法尤其适用于多种语言的翻译更新,请注意自己的安装路径哦~

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Qt
    优质
    本文提供了一个用于批量翻译Qt语言文件的脚本,并详细解释了其工作原理和使用方法。适合需要高效管理多国语言资源的开发者阅读。 Qt语言家批量翻译脚本附详细说明:指定需要更新的.ts文件,以空格分隔,可以批量更新。将该脚本放置在正确目录下,并将.txt文件改名为.bat后可以直接双击运行。此方法尤其适用于多种语言的翻译更新,请注意自己的安装路径哦~
  • Qt工具.rar
    优质
    该资源为一款用于Qt项目中实现多国语言快速切换与管理的批量翻译工具脚本,适用于需要频繁更新界面语言包的开发者。 Qt语言家批量翻译脚本附详细说明:指定需要更新的.ts文件,并用空格隔开,可以批量进行更新操作。将该脚本放置在正确目录下,然后把.txt文件改为.bat后缀名,双击即可运行。此方法对于多种语言的翻译更新特别有用。请记得确认自己的安装路径哦~
  • Shell的使用(全面)
    优质
    本书《Shell脚本语言的使用详解》提供了一站式的Shell编程指南,深入浅出地介绍了从基础语法到高级应用的所有关键概念和技术细节。 ### 1. Shell的概述 Shell 是一种脚本语言。 - **脚本**:本质上是一个文件,其中存放的是特定格式的指令。系统使用脚本解析器来翻译或执行这些指令(不需要编译)。 - **Shell**:既是应用程序又是解释型的语言。 在Linux中,常见的shell命令解析器有 sh、ash 和 bash 等。要查看当前系统的默认 shell 解析器,请输入 `echo $SHELL` 命令。 编写并运行一个 Shell 脚本需要以下步骤: 1. 使用文本编辑器创建脚本段落件。 2. 为脚本添加执行权限(例如:`chmod +x scriptname.sh`)。 3. 在安装了相应shell解释器的环境中,可以通过多种方式调用该脚本来执行任务。 ### 2. 脚本的调用形式 当打开终端时,默认会自动调用 `etcprof` 文件。Shell 脚本语言允许用户通过编写特定格式的指令来自动化系统任务。 - **直接执行**:使用 `.scriptname.sh` 命令,根据脚本首行中的 shebang(如 `#!/bin/bash`)指定解析器进行执行;如果没有指定,则会默认使用当前系统的 shell 解析器。 - **明确指定shell执行**:通过命令 `bash scriptname.sh` 来运行脚本。即使没有在脚本中指明shebang,也会用 bash 作为解释器。 - **使用 `.source` 命令执行**:通过输入 `. scriptname.sh` 或 `source scriptname.sh`,可以在当前 shell 环境下直接执行脚本的命令。 编写shell脚本时需要注意以下基本语法: 1. 注释以 `#` 开头; 2. 使用变量赋值语句如 `变量名=变量值` 以及引用 `$变量名` 的方式来使用和清除变量。 3. 字符串处理中,双引号内会解析其中的变量(例如:`echo $var`),而单引号则不会解析。 预设环境变量(比如 `$HOME`)可以直接在脚本中使用。当需要进行路径追加时,请确保正确地扩展 PATH 变量: ```bash export PATH=$PATH:newpath ``` 条件测试通常涉及 `test` 或 `[ ]` 命令,可用来检查文件状态、字符串和数值等。 控制结构如 `if-else` 语句、循环(for 和 while)用于管理脚本流程。 掌握这些基础知识后,你就可以开始编写简单的shell脚本来自动化各种任务了。随着对更多高级特性的学习与理解,将能够创建更复杂的脚本以提高工作效率和系统管理水平。
  • TCL手册(内容
    优质
    《TCL脚本语言手册》是一份全面介绍TCL编程语言的手册,涵盖了语法、命令和高级应用技巧等内容。适合初学者及进阶开发者参考使用。 TCL脚本语言的语法是硬件开发人员调试硬件的重要工具。掌握其详细内容对于提高工作效率具有重要意义。
  • TCL教程
    优质
    《TCL脚本语言详解教程》是一份全面解析Tcl编程语言的指南,深入浅出地介绍了Tcl的基本语法、高级特性和实用案例,适合初学者和进阶用户。 该文件是关于TCL脚本语言的详细教程,非常适合新手入门。
  • Qt文件.rar
    优质
    本资源为一款能够帮助开发者高效管理与翻译Qt项目中各类字符串的工具包。通过该软件,用户可以轻松实现对多个Qt项目的批量翻译工作,极大提高开发效率。 1. 单机源ts编辑框即可选择ts路径(目标ts是生成后的ts文件,并与源ts文件位于同一目录); 2. 选择源语言(如:中文),以及目标语言(例如,将中文翻译成英文,则输入“中文”为源,“英文”为目标)。 3. 选择翻译API(目前仅提供百度翻译API,如有需要可自行开发,下面会介绍如何进行开发工作); 4. 若没有百度翻译的账号和密钥,请先申请。获取密钥后打开Qt批量翻译ts.exe.config文件并修改相关参数。
  • PowerBuilder培训课件:对powerScript的
    优质
    该课程提供全面深入的PowerBuilder脚本语言(powerScript)培训资料,旨在帮助学员掌握从基础语法到高级编程技巧的所有知识。 PowerBuilder培训课件详细介绍PowerScript,内容非常详尽,值得学习。
  • TCL的中文
    优质
    《TCL脚本语言的中文详解》是一本全面解析TCL编程语言的指南书籍,深入浅出地介绍了TCL的基本语法、高级特性和应用实例,适合初学者及进阶读者。 Tcl脚本语言中文详解以更易理解的方式介绍了该编程语言的各个方面。通过这种方式,读者能够更好地掌握Tcl的基本概念、语法结构以及如何编写简单的程序。文章涵盖了从入门到进阶的各种知识点,并提供了丰富的示例代码帮助学习者加深理解和应用能力。 重写后的文字并没有包含任何联系方式和网址链接等信息,只保留了关于Tcl脚本语言的内容介绍部分。
  • C指针(经典析).pdf
    优质
    本书为《C语言指针详解》的经典版本,全面深入地剖析了C语言中的指针概念与应用技巧,适合希望深化理解C语言编程原理的读者阅读。 指针在C语言中的使用涉及到多个概念的理解:包括指针的类型、所指向的数据结构特性以及它占据的内存空间大小。 首先来看几个例子: (1) `int* ptr;` 指针所指向的是整型数据。 (2) `char* ptr;` 指向字符类型的变量或数组。 (3) `int** ptr;` 这是一个二级指针,即它指向一个存放整数地址的内存位置。 (4) `int(*ptr)[3];` 该声明表示指针指向包含三个整型元素的数组。 (5) `int* (*ptr)[4];` 指向含有四个整数类型指针的数据结构。 从这些例子中,我们可以看出,每个指针所指向的具体数据类型决定了它如何被使用和解释。例如,在基本类型的指针(如(1) 和 (2))情况下,它们分别用于存储整型或字符型变量的地址;而更复杂的声明则涉及到数组或其它复杂的数据结构。 接下来讨论的是关于指针值的概念:即一个内存位置标识符,该标识符允许程序访问特定数据。当我们使用解引用操作`*ptr`时,我们实际上是在获取由指针指向的具体内存区域中的实际数值内容(例如整数、字符等),而不是指针本身的地址。 考虑以下代码段: ```c int num = 10; int *ptr = # ``` 这里,变量 `num` 的地址被赋值给指针 `ptr`。当我们使用表达式 `*ptr`时,我们实际上是在访问存储在由 `ptr` 指向的内存位置中的数据——即整数10。 最后一点是关于指针本身占用的内存大小:每个指针变量都占据了特定数量的字节(通常是4或8个字节),这取决于计算机架构。这些字节用于存放指向实际数据存储地址的信息。 ```c int *ptr; printf(Size of int pointer: %d bytes\n, sizeof(ptr)); ``` 上述代码段会输出指针 `ptr` 占用的内存大小,帮助开发者理解其占用的空间。 综上所述,掌握C语言中关于指针的各种概念(包括它的类型、指向的数据结构特性以及它所占据的内存空间)是有效使用这种强大的编程工具的关键。通过深入了解这些细节,并进行实践练习,可以大大提升程序开发能力并避免常见的错误。
  • DehazeNet 注释
    优质
    《DehazeNet翻译详解及注释》一文深入解析了用于图像去雾处理的DehazeNet网络架构,详尽解释每一部分代码与技术细节,并提供实用注释以帮助理解。 对蔡博士的DehazeNet文献进行翻译时,并不是简单地使用机器翻译结果。而是逐句修改并突出重点部分,在此基础上添加个人的理解和批注。同时,确保这些内容与相关程序相呼应。